The post holder will:

Coach and motivate patients through multiple sessions to identify their needs, set goals, and support them to implement their personalised health and care plan. Provide personalised support to individuals, their families, and carers to ensure that they are active participants in their own healthcare; empowering them to take more control in managing their own health and wellbeing, to live independently, and improve their health outcomes through:

  • Providing interventions such as self-management education and peer support.
  • Supporting people to establish and attain goals set by the person based on what is important to them, building on goals that are important to the individual.
  • Working with the social prescribing service to connect them to community-based activities which support their health and wellbeing.

To be involved in group activities, consultations, and support groups to facilitate improvements in health and well-being. Provide support to local community groups and work with other health, social care, and voluntary sector providers to support the patients' health and well-being holistically. Facilitate groups of patients in group consultations to assist patients to work with others for their own goals, including case finding groups of like-minded people. Utilise existing IT and MDT channels to screen patients, with an aim to identify those that would benefit from health coaching.

To be able to plan and respond to workload according to operational priorities. To support the delivery of these functions across wider locality areas where necessary. To undertake any training required in order to maintain competency including mandatory training. The Health and Wellbeing Coach is expected to take responsibility for self-development on a continuous basis, undertaking on-the-job training as required.
